The hotel is now officially a Westin. I am in DC and saw the sign being replaced on Tuesday. I got an email on Wednesday, October 4 that the hotel is now the Westin. My reservation number stayed the same and "all elite benefits will be provided accordingly." I cancelled the reservation as I don't need it now anyway - hah.

Note: I walked into the lobby this week and it looked exactly the same as it did when it was the Renaissance. Only difference was the sports bar towards the back looked a bit different.

Checked into this hotel for the first time since the re-flag. Asked for a room with the Peloton bike and was told no problem. But that was quickly followed up by a comment that all the Peloton bikes that are put into the rooms are "missing a part" and will not work. Something to do with the power adapter.

I've also head from another hotel (I'm close friends with the GM) that they had to remove the Peloton bikes from the gym because of a recall. Yet the Westin claims the Peloton bikes in their gym work (I didn't check).

So...don't book a room with the Peloton hoping it will work right now. Save the $.

Finally, a hotel in DC that agreed to give me an 'upgrade' when asked at check-in without issue.

Current breakfast benefit is "scrambled eggs on toast" entree or $17 off per person - regardless, coffee and orange juice seem to be included (ex. entree prices were $14 for the breakfast sandwich and $18 for the pancakes (stack of four)) - however, you also get a $30 daily food and beverage credit from the $30 destination fee, which per discussion at check-in, seems like it should also apply to breakfast. We'll see at check-out, but I got two entrees and both were tasty. You order at the counter and then they bring food and beverages out to your table in the lobby (bustling).

I had a lot of nerves before staying here based on relatively poor reviews during renovations and when the property was previously a Renaissance. Regardless, my fears were relatively unfounded. This is a solid US hotel that meets brand standards, IMO - here are my impressions:
  • Property appeared mostly sold out online - regardless, had seen an upgrade to Park View King before arrival - upon arrival, the agent told me he had a really good room with two beds, but then after a bunch of phone calls and typing, told me that I should take a 10th floor City View King instead - there werent any actual upgrades online, so no issue there
  • I have never seen a busier hotel lobby - massive convention, but not really any lines at front desk
  • Room is kind of dimly lit but is updated with Westin styling - in contrast to Westin Georgetown, lack of carpeting here makes the room feel a tad cold
  • Bed was great - plush mattress, plush pillows, plush covers
  • Lounger was comfortable
  • Internet TV OS present
  • View of Conrad and parking lot not super inspiring, but thats DC
  • Delivered large cheese plate as welcome gift - some tasty cheeses
  • Offered late checkout - no issue with 3 PM
  • Housekeeping refresh performed proactively
  • As mentioned a post above, breakfast is scrambled eggs on toast entree + free coffee and juice or $17 off entree + free coffee and juice - the destination fee also has a $30 F&B daily credit that I ended up underutilizing as the restaurant staff wiped my breakfast check by ringing me up for 2 (I ordered two entrees - $14 breakfast sandwich and $18 pancakes - each morning) - but destination fee credit did wipe the tips each morning - I thought the food was quite tasty and good quality
  • Potential issue with mosquitos in my room or outside - ended up with disparate single bites on random sides of my body (it wasnt other types of pests based on bite pattern) - I think I shouldnt have left the cheese plate out - not necessarily blaming the hotel as I never caught one but felt like I kept seeing something fly out of the corner of my eye
  • No smell issue as reported upthread - room smelled fine

I wouldnt have an issue returning.
